Tradeify is a fast-growing fintech company focused on empowering traders through access to capital and modern trading tools. We’re scaling quickly, broadening our product portfolio and markets, and investing in marketing to fuel the next stage of growth.
As Senior Paid Media Manager, you will own cross-channel paid media end to end-strategy, execution, measurement, forecasting, and pacing - to help accelerate this growth story. You’ll manage substantial multi-platform budgets (Google Ads, Meta, Microsoft Advertising/Bing, X/Twitter, Reddit, Spotify, and more), build systems (including AI-enabled alerts and QA guardrails)
Key Responsibilities
- Strategy & Execution: Plan, launch, and scale integrated campaigns across search, social, display, and audio to hit growth goals.
- Budgeting, Pacing & P&L: Forecast spend, manage pacing by channel/geo/audience, and protect efficiency (no over/underspend).
- Experimentation: Build and run structured test roadmaps (bids, audiences, creative, landing pages), document learnings, and operationalize wins.
- Measurement & Analytics: Own conversion tracking, pixels, UTMs, and events. Build dashboards and deep dives in Looker Studio and GA4; translate analysis into decisions.
- Cross-Functional & Agency Collaboration: Partner closely with Creative, Web, Sales/RevOps, and Data, and coordinate with external agency partners/contractors to align messaging, landing experiences, and attribution.
- Systems & Safeguards: Design and maintain scalable operating systems-integrate AI where useful (e.g., scripted alerts, anomaly detection, bulk QA, creative variant generation), and implement QA checklists and guardrails to prevent errors and budget leakage.
- Communication & Reporting: Deliver weekly pacing updates and executive-ready narratives; present forecasts and “what it takes” models for different growth scenarios.
Required Qualifications (applications without these will not be considered)
- 7+ years of hands-on paid media experience (minimum 5-7 years) owning multi-channel campaigns.
- Direct ownership of at least 4 of the following platforms: Google Ads, Meta Ads, Microsoft Advertising/Bing, X (Twitter) Ads, Reddit Ads, Spotify Ads Manager.
- Proven track record managing $5M+ per year in aggregate paid media spend while meeting or beating CAC/ROAS targets.
- Expert in Looker Studio (Data Studio) and Google Analytics 4, plus experience with at least one user-level analytics platform (e.g., Amplitude, Mixpanel, Heap).
- Strong understanding of machine-learning bidding strategies (e.g., tROAS, tCPA, Maximize Conversions/Value)-how they learn, ramp, and can be guided via signal quality, budgets, conversion definitions, and audience seeds.
- Demonstrated competence in forecasting, scenario modeling, and channel-level P&L management.
- Excellent written and verbal communication skills; able to brief creatives, align stakeholders, and present to leadership.

What you need to know about the Montreal Tech Scene
With roots dating back to 1642, Montreal is often recognized for its French-inspired architecture and cobblestone streets lined with traditional shops and cafés. But what truly sets the city apart is how it blends its rich tradition with a modern edge, reflected in its evolving skyline and fast-growing tech industry. According to economic promotion agency Montréal International, the city ranks among the top in North America to invest in artificial intelligence, making it le spot idéal for job seekers who want the best of both worlds.
Key Facts About Montreal Tech
- Number of Tech Workers: 255,000+ (2024, Tourisme Montréal)
- Major Tech Employers: SAP, Google, Microsoft, Cisco
-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, machine learning, cybersecurity, cloud computing, web development
- Funding Landscape: $1.47 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(BetaKit)
- Notable Investors: CIBC Innovation Banking, BDC Capital, Investissement Québec, Fonds de solidarité FTQ
- Research Centers and Universities: McGill University, Université de Montréal, Concordia University, Mila Quebec, ÉTS Montréal
